Kaolinite-methanol-sodium stearate intercalation compound (Ka-MeOH-SS) was prepared by intercalation of kaolinite with d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O) followed by displacing of DMSO with methanol and methanol by sodium stearate. The sample was characterized by X-ray diffraction (XRD),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R), thermal analysis (thermogravimetry (TGA) and differential scanning calorimetry (DSC)) and transmission electron microscopy (TEM). The results show that the basal spacing of Ka-MeOH-SS was enlarged to 45.5-47.9 Å and parts of its layers cocked and curled. Stearate ions were grafted on the methoxy groups and arrayed aslant in the interlayer space of kaolinite with an inclination angle of 47.45° to 52.17°. Sodium ions were adsorbed around the SiO 4 tetrahedron and interlayer carboxylate anions, whereas some of them entered into the ditrigonal hole of tetrahedral sheets. The thermal de-intercalation of Ka-MeOH-SS includes three steps and the activation energy E is 98.3 kJ mol −1 , logarithm of pre-exponential factor lg(A / s -1 ) is 9.71 and the mechanism function is f(α) = −ln (1 − α) and G(α) = 1 − α.
In the boiler combustion of power plants, the smoke loss is the main combustion heat loss of the boiler. Reducing the exhaust gas temperature is one of the main means to reduce the heat loss of the exhaust gas, and it is also the main measure for improving the thermal efficiency of the boiler in each power plant. This paper summarizes and discusses the application and economics of installing composite phase change heat exchangers for coal-fired boilers.
